Parents often have an easier time enforcing rules if they are setting good examples for their children. When it comes to drinking, drug use, and other risky behaviors, it is not always enough to tell your children these behaviors are forbidden. Parents should model the behavior they want to see. Drinking in moderation and abstaining from drug and nicotine teaches children about boundaries and responsible behaviors and reinforces the message that dangerous substances really are dangerous.
